Re: Problem with the sim card
Quote:
cmt 003 is Chinese variant once you have flashed chinense cmt, you cannot change it back to western version, 003 can only be updated with 003. You can try to flash D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3_PR_LEGACY_003-OEM1-958 (find it here https://talk.maemo.org/showthread.php?t=96401) flasher -F 003version.bin --flash-only=cmt -f -R |

Re: Problem with the sim card
[QUOTE=mike727;1530655]Thanks, feel relieved now that it's booted.
So it is now 299 & 003 (CMT). IMEI is present. It indicates total storage as 6.28 GB Error message; "Can't access user data"QUOTE] You would need to cold flash to re-write partitions once you have identified a firmware version:http://talk.maemo.org/showpost.php?p...postcount=1512 There is no separate New Zealand firmware as 299 is country variant Australia and of course you have tried D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3_PR_LEGACY_005-OEM1-958_ARM.bin As regards your highlighted firmwares, please note the following if helps to make an assessment: 059L6B8,335,N9 RM-696 Country Variant United Arab Emirates AE CLI8 Black 16G,7088057028,D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3.335.1_PR_LEGACY_335_ARM_RM-696_PRD_signed.bin 059L7Z9,341,N9 RM-696 PTK Centertel (Orange PL) PL Black V2 - MR,7149480848,D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3.341.2_PR_LEGACY_341_ARM_RM-696_PRD_signed.bin 059L449,420,N9 RM-696 Telcel MX MX Black V3,7146675574,D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3.420.4_PR_LEGACY_420_ARM_RM-696_PRD_signed.bin 059N2D9,468,N9 RM-696 Country Variant United Arab Emirates AE N9 UAE White -,7087361817,D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3.468.1_PR_LEGACY_468_ARM_RM-696_PRD_signed.bin The following is last resort as highest number available with no going back. 059L5D4,480,N9 RM-696 Country Variant Switzerland CH Black 64GB V1,7099600534,DFL61_HARMATTAN_40.2012.21-3.480.04.1_PR_LEGACY_480_ARM_RM-696_PRD_signed.bin |
